Here you see the squad complete. One day I will figure out the settings on my camera :)
The armor is basecoated Dark Angels green with Snot Green highlighting. Robes are Adaptus Battle Grey with a custom mix of grey+bone for the highlight. The shadows were greated using a mix of grey+red.
Te marines are metal dark angels. The sargent is a converted chaplain Asmodai ((converted by Alex Nemes))
The back robe shadows are a mix of grey+blue. I really hope they kick some ass in the upcomming Winter Skirmish! See everyone there!

The second step is to cut the decal from its sheet and dip into clean water. When this is done the paper will turn a darker blue which tells you it has absorbed enough water. Place the decal on a piece of paper towel. Dip a brush into the decal set, apply it to the damp decal and the surface you will apply the decal too. Slide the decal into place using tweezers and blot the decal with a brush to smooth en it out. The decal set solution dries in about 5 Min's
When the decal dries, apply a cote of 'ard cote. This will seal in the decal and prevent the decal from ever being damaged. But now the shoulder is very glossy! not good at all.
When the 'ard cote hardens, apply a layer of dull cote to the area that is shiny. The dull cote will tone down the finish. If possible, do not make multiple passes. The dull cote can damage areas that have been already painted that are not protected by 'ard cote. After this step, I add a touch of weathering to the decal to make it appear painted or natural. Your done!

First item of discussion, tamiya plastic cement. This is liquid wonder for constructing anything made from polystyrene. It is very thin and holds very strong. The small brush included with the bottle really helps getting cement in those tight spaces. The cost: $5
The next items are the weathering masters. I use series 1 and series 2 almost exclusively. As shown, the first one comes in sand, light sand and mud and the second one comes in snow, soot and rust. There basically made from ground pigment. They can be applied using the feather brush to make a dusty look, the foam applicator to make smears or a damp paintbrush to make stains. The cost: $11
The last product I will discuss, which really makes this project, well, not shine is the weathering sticks. These babies set my back about $6 each stick, but are well worth the investment. From what I can tell, there made of basically ground pigment the is moist. It has a texture like damp clay. There is basically two ways to apply it, smearing and dabbing. Smearing makes it look like mud that hasn't stuck to the vehicle, and makes a smooth finish. When dabbing, it makes nice chunks of pigment that really looks like built up mud around the tracks. Be warned tho, dabbing uses the stick at an alarming rate.
